Delta variant: 43 infections detected in Velvettiturai and Point Pedro
By Dinasena Ratugamage
The Jaffna Health Officials on Thursday night (15) decided to isolate four villages in Valvettiturai and Point Pedro, in the Jaffna peninsula, following the detection of several dozens of coronavirus Delta variant infections.
The health officers said that they had detected 43 patients with the Delta strain from those villages.
The Office of the Provincial Director of Health Services – North said that they had not yet decided to isolate the village in Kilinochchi where patients with the Delta strain were detected.
“Two COVID-19 patients who were being treated at the Jaffna Teaching Hospital died soon after admission. We don’t know if they had contracted the Delta variant but those infected with this variant were found in villages in that area.”
